摘要
Business students are thoroughly schooled about the importance of measurement systems that, by their very nature, are designed to accurately measure the past performance of organizations, departments, and individuals. This article describes a team-based, active-learning exercise that clearly illustrates an additional important and often under-emphasized aspect of performance measurement systems-their influence on individuals' future behaviors and organizations' future performance.
